Mullins Named MVC Women's XC Scholar-Athlete of the Year

Emilie Meyer and Carmen Krawczysnki Gonzalez joined Mullins on the MVC Scholar-Athlete team.

ST. LOUIS -- Brooke Mullins of Drake cross country was selected as the 2023 Missouri Valley Conference Women's Cross Country Scholar-Athlete of the Year, the league announced on Wednesday, Nov. 8. Emilie Meyer and Carmen Krawczynski Gonzalez also earned spots on the MVC Women's Cross Country Scholar-Athlete team.

Brooke Mullins carries a 3.86 grade point average majoring in management & organizational leadership. She ran a 6k personal best and course record of 20:13.8 to be the first Drake women's cross country runner since Ashley Anklam in 2006 to win at the MVC Championships. Mullins cemented herself as the sixth-ever women's cross country individual champion from Drake.
 
Emilie Meyer (21:49.5) finished 18th in the MVC XC Championships and Carmen Krawczynski Gonzalez (21:51.6) was 20th both. Meyer is a business studies major with a 3.91 major while Krawczynski Gonzalez has a 3.84 GPA majoring in psychology. 

The Drake men's and women's cross country programs will compete in the NCAA Midwest Regional on Friday, Nov. 10 in Stillwater, Okla.
